What Is an Evaporative Cooler?
An evaporative cooler, also known as a swamp cooler, uses the natural process of evaporation to cool air. It works by drawing warm outside air through water-saturated pads, where the air is cooled by evaporation before being circulated indoors. This method is energy-efficient and environmentally friendly.
Assessing Your Needs
Before installation, evaluate your cooling needs. Consider the size of the space, climate conditions, and existing ventilation. Evaporative coolers are most effective in dry, low-humidity areas and for spaces with good airflow.
Calculating Cooling Capacity
Determine the cooling capacity required, typically measured in CFM (cubic feet per minute). A general rule is 20 CFM per square foot of space. Accurate calculations ensure you select a unit that adequately cools your area.

Installation Steps
Follow these steps for a proper installation:
1. Choose the Location
Select a suitable spot that meets the criteria above. Ensure there is enough space for the unit and access for maintenance.
2. Prepare the Site
Level the surface and install any mounting brackets if necessary. Check water and power connections before proceeding.
3. Connect Water Supply
Attach the water supply hose to the cooler’s water inlet. Ensure the connection is secure and check for leaks.
4. Power Connection
Plug the cooler into a grounded electrical outlet. Use a surge protector if recommended by the manufacturer.
5. Testing and Adjustment
Turn on the cooler and verify proper operation. Adjust airflow and water levels as needed for optimal cooling.
Maintenance and Safety Tips
Regular maintenance ensures efficiency and longevity. Keep water tanks clean, replace pads periodically, and check for leaks. Follow safety guidelines, including proper electrical connections and water handling.
Routine Maintenance
- Clean water tanks weekly
- Replace water pads as recommended
- Check electrical connections regularly
Safety Precautions
- Ensure the unit is unplugged before maintenance
- Keep water away from electrical components
- Follow manufacturer instructions carefully
